Abstract
An apparatus that employs a pair of high peripheral speed impact cutters to remove hard carbonaceous deposits from the lateral surfaces of the refractory lining of coke oven doors. The motion of these cutters is synchronized with that of an element of the apparatus which displaces it from one position to another on the door, and, in one embodiment, means are also provided to scrape tarry carbonaceous deposits from the door's seal ring.
